1. At the outset, Mr. Mistri, the learned Senior Counsel appearing on behalf of the Petitioner tenders a copy of draft amendments to the above Writ Petition. The draft amendments are only to bring certain documents on record which were not annexed to the Petition and the averments in relation thereto. Considering this is a formal amendment, the draft amendments tendered to the Court are taken on record and marked “X” for identification. The Petitioner is permitted to carry out the amendments as per the draft handed in. The amendments shall be carried out by tomorrow. Reverification is dispensed with.

2. By the present Petition, the Petitioner has impugned (i) the notice dated 8th August 2024, issued u/s. 148A(b) of the Income Tax Act, 1961 (“the Act”), (ii) the order dated 29th August 2024, passed u/s. 148A(d) of the Act, (iii) the notice dated 29th August 2024 issued u/s. 148 of the Act. The relevant Assessment Year (A.Y.) is 2018-19. By the Notice dated 29th August 2024, the 1st Respondent has reopened the assessment of the Petitioner for A.Y. 2018- 19. The Revenue has filed its Reply dated 5th October 2024 to the Petition, which is affirmed on behalf of the 1st Respondent by one Mr. Rajesh Shahir.

3. In the present petition Rule was issued and interim relief was granted in terms of prayer clause (d) vide Order dated 23rd September, 2024.

4. The Pleadings are complete, and therefore, with the consent of the parties, we have heard the Petition finally.

5. The facts and circumstances leading to the notices and the order impugned in the present Petition are as follows: -

(i) The Petitioner is a charitable Trust registered u/s. 12A of the Act. The objects of the Trust are as follows:

“(a) The foundation, maintenance and support of a Technological School or Schools and Institutes, Polytechnical School or Schools or Institutes. Hunnar Shala, Workshops and Industrial and vocational classes for the training of Parsi Zoroastrian young men in the arts and crafts of the factory workshop and as artisans in skilled designs and works and in all manner of handicrafts wood stone and other materials. As ancillary to and in aid of the above objects to take execute and carry out orders from customers and others for the furniture and works turned out in any of the aforesaid schools, institutes, workshops, classes or departments and the receipts and revenue therefrom shall be held as part of the income of the Trusts Funds and applied accordingly.

(b) The grant of scholarships, subscriptions, donations, prizes and other forms of support to schools and Parsi Zoroastrian young men conducive to the aforesaid objects (but not outside India) if funds permit.

(c) The relief of and grant of employment to adult as also elderly Parsi Zoroastrian males.

(d) Provision and maintenance of male Parsi Zoroastrians as apprentices whether in any institute conducted hereunder or in any other factories workshops in India.

(e) To do all such other things as are incidental or conducive to the attainment of the above objects.

(f) To provide by construction of building or otherwise in any manner whatsoever, as the Trustees in their absolute discretion may think fit housing facilities to Parsi Zoroastrian males and females and letting out the building or otherwise allowing the use and occupations of the buildings or parts thereof to Parsi Zoroastrians, males and females
